The 26-acre campus includes academic buildings; two libraries; administrative buildings; a separate performing arts center with classrooms dance studio and a 450-seat theater-auditorium; a 23,000 square-foot innovative creative arts center; a 40,000 square-foot athletic center; and 4 turf fields. The Lifes came to Rye and established the Rye Female Seminary under the direction of Mrs. Life. Its Upper School (grades 9-12), Middle School (5-8), and Lower School (Pre-Kindergarten-4) enroll a total of 886 students on its 26-acre campus.
